Welcome to "Healthy Mind, Healthy Life," the podcast that explores the secrets to living a vibrant and fulfilling life. I'm your host, Avik, and I am thrilled to have a very special guest joining us today - Al Lyman.

At the age of 25, Al made a life-changing decision to "die healthy" and embarked on a lifelong quest for good health, vitality, and longevity. His journey led him to finish dozens of marathons, conquer nine Ironman triathlons, and even write a book titled "Age Well and Feel Great: The Proven Path to Solving the Aging Puzzle" at the age of 62.
